The Art of Smartphone Aesthetics: Huawei's Gradient Game

The smartphone market is abuzz with anticipation as Huawei teases its upcoming global launch of the Pura 90s Pro Max. In a strategic move, the tech giant is building excitement by revealing a stunning design element: a mesmerizing gradient color scheme. This marketing tactic is a clever way to capture attention and create a buzz, especially in an industry where design aesthetics play a significant role in consumer choices.

What makes this particularly intriguing is Huawei's decision to maintain the same design across global markets, despite historical variations in their phone models. Typically, Huawei introduces subtle changes when launching phones overseas, catering to different supply chain dynamics and software ecosystems. However, this time, they seem committed to a unified aesthetic, as evidenced by the 'Orange Ocean' shade showcased in the teaser.

The 'Orange Ocean' color option is a brilliant choice, evoking a sense of summer with its sunset orange and beach-like blue hues. This strategic color selection is not just about aesthetics; it's a subtle nod to the season and a clever way to create an emotional connection with potential buyers. From a marketing perspective, this is a powerful strategy to differentiate their product in a highly competitive market.

One detail that I find fascinating is the camera bump. The Pura 90s Pro Max sports a substantial camera bump, wider and thicker than its predecessors. This design choice is a bold statement, emphasizing the device's photography capabilities. In an era where smartphone cameras are increasingly becoming the primary tool for photography, this design element is not just functional but also a visual representation of the phone's core strength.
